A SIMPLE AND EFFECTIVE METHOD FOR THE REDUCTION OF ACYL SUBSTITUTED HETEROCYCLIC 1,3-DICARBONYL COMPOUNDS TO ALKYL DERIVATIVES BY ZINC - ACETIC-ACID - HYDROCHLORIC-ACID

摘要
3-Acyl-4-hydroxy-2(1H)-quinolones (1a-k) were reduced in good yields (66-97%) to 3-alkyl-4-hydroxy-2(1H)-quinolinones (2a-k) using zinc powder (particle size <45 mu M) in acetic acid/hydrochloric acid. This method could be transformed to 3-acetyl-4-hydroxy-coumarin (1l), 3-acetyl-4-hydroxy-2-pyranone (3a) and 3-acetyl-4-hydroxy-2(1H)-pyridinone (3b), which yielded the 3-ethyl derivatives 21, 4a and 4b, respectively.
